Very similar to my default settings, and there's some excellent comments above as well.
If you want a larger default terminal size, then adjust Window->Columns and Rows.
As for font, I used to use Lucida Console, but got frustrated with the minimal UTF-8 support that it has. A good alternative is Deja Vu Sans Mono (8 pt). It's roughly the same size as LC 9pt, has better distinction between capital O and zero, and has VASTLY better UTF-8 support.
In Connection->Data change the default terminal type. What you should change it to largely depends on the remote system, but I would recommend either putty-256color or xterm-256color.
